Decibels (dB) measure the ratio between two power levels, indicating how much one value is amplified or attenuated compared to another, without an absolute reference. It’s a logarithmic scale that simplifies large range comparisons in signal strength or power.

Decibel-milliwatts (dBm) express power levels relative to 1 milliwatt. It provides an absolute measure of power in electronic systems, where 0 dBm equals 1 milliwatt, making it easier to compare actual power levels in communication devices.
